Abstract

The invention discloses a tipping system of a dual-purpose foldback tippler and a use method thereof. The tipping system of the dual-purpose foldback tippler comprises a heavy vehicle line, a shunter rail, an empty vehicle line and an air-conditioning vehicle rail, wherein the heavy vehicle line is provided with a tippler and a transfer platform; the shunter rail is provided with the heavy vehicle shunter; the part close to the transfer platform on the empty vehicle is provided with a first stopper; the air-conditioning vehicle rail is provided with an empty vehicle shunter; the part close to the vehicle-in end of the tippler on the heavy vehicle line is provided with a wheel clamper; a part between the vehicle-out end of the tippler and the transfer platform on the heavy vehicle line is provided with a second stopper; a vehicle body of the transfer platform sequentially consists of a first vehicle body, a second vehicle body and a third vehicle body; the third vehicle body is arranged close to the vehicle-out end of the tippler; an end disc of the tippler adopts a C-shaped opening form; and the heavy vehicle shunter is arranged close to the vehicle-in end of the tippler. With the design, the stepout gondola cars and three non-stepout gondola cars can be tipped, and the tipping system has higher tipping efficiency, smaller floor area and lower production cost.

Technical field
The present invention relates to a kind of circular type tipper dumping system, relate in particular to a kind of dual purpose circular type tipper dumping system and method for application thereof, specifically be applicable to the dumping of off-the-line and non-off-the-line open-top car.
Background technology
Existing most of Zigzag type overturning system can only the dumping off-the-line the common railway open-top car, for the C63, the C80 open-top car that are equipped with rotatable coupler, direct dumping, can only off-the-line after, one carries out dumping successively.But, because C80 open-top car major part is one group at three joints, connect with rotatable fixed link between three joints, between every group with ten No. six, ten No. seven rotatable couplers connections, so one carry out dumping successively after the off-the-line that do not suit.Simultaneously, though early stage C80 open-top car has only Qun Dynasty's line special-purpose basically, along with the increase in demand of railway freight; The Ministry of Railways has notified Qun Dynasty's line some tippers along the line to use enterprise successively at the beginning of 2008; Therefore need carry out the dead work of dumping C80, must design the dumping system that is adapted to dumping C80 open-top car, present domestic be used for dumping these not the dumping system of off-the-line open-top car be mostly through layout; If take into account dumping off-the-line open-top car, then lower, the cost of efficiency ratio is than higher.So, invent a kind of while and can dumping off-the-line open-top car and three save not the Zigzag type dumping system of off-the-line open-top car and just seem and be necessary very much in some places that receives place, cost limitations.
The Chinese patent Granted publication number is CN201287976Y; Granted publication day is that the utility model patent on August 12nd, 2009 discloses a kind of unloading system of circular type tipper; Be mainly used in steel mill, power plant and harbour etc.; Its formation mainly contains tipper, loaded vehicle shunt machine, transfer platform, empty wagons shunt machine, clip wheel device, also has bicycle the shunt machine and the trochus that rises.The scheme though this tipper unloading system, employing sectional type are shunt has realized cross-operation; Improved the complex operation rate of tipper unloading system, but it is suitable for not off-the-line open-top car of dumping, if in order to dumping off-the-line open-top car then efficient reduce greatly; Dumping off-the-line open-top car and three saves not off-the-line open-top car so be not suitable for simultaneously, more is not suitable for dumping C80 open-top car, in addition; Its parts that need are more, and not only productive costs is higher, and floor area is bigger.
